Standard Products

STMicroelectronics Standard Products are a broad range of industry-standard and drop-in replacements for the most popular general-purpose analog ICs, discretes, and serial EEPROMs. The Standard Products are manufactured to the highest quality standards with many AECQ-qualified for automotive applications. A comprehensive set of STMicroelectronics design aids, including SPICE, IBIS models, and simulation tools, is available to make adding to a design-in easy.

Low-Power High Accuracy Operational Amplifiers

STMicroelectronics Low-Power High Accuracy Operational Amplifiers features micropower consumption, zero drift, rail to rail, low-voltage offset, high voltage, and low input bias current. STMicroelectronics offers a micropower op amp portfolio with consumption as low as 2µA, standard and high-performance op amps, and space-saving packages, such as DFN, QFN, SOT-23, and SC-70. These devices also provide guaranteed specified minimum/maximum electrical performances. Ideal applications include sensor signal conditioning, battery-operated devices, medical instrumentation, power, AFE for high voltage sensors, computers, and tablets.

TSX63x Micropower Rail-to-Rail Op Amps

STMicroelectronics TSX63 Micropower Rail-to-Rail Operational Amplifiers offer low voltage operation and rail-to-rail input and output. TSX631 is the single version, TSX632 the dual version and TSX634 the quad version, with pinouts compatible with industry standards. The TSX63x and TSX63xA series offer a 200kHz gain bandwidth product while consuming 60μA maximum at 16V. The devices are housed in the tiniest industrial packages. These features make the TSX63x and TSX63xA family ideal for sensor interfaces and industrial signal conditioning. The wide temperature range and high ESD tolerance ease the use in harsh automotive applications.

TSX Series of Operational Amplifiers

STMicroelectronics TSX Series of Operational Amplifiers are a new generation of 16V Amplifier ICs using an advanced manufacturing process, combining high performance and high reliability, making them well suited for a variety of demanding applications. An innovative 16V CMOS manufacturing process delivers reduced power consumption and class-leading accuracy with long term stability, and enables reduced PCB area by allowing the use of small surface-mount packages. These devices are used as signal-conditioning solutions for rugged applications from automotive electronics to smart buildings and industrial controls.
